I haven’t been studying it, but the weather is certainly the big item for emergency responders all around the northern hemisphere this week. The upper half of the U. S. is being assaulted by a wave of winter storms that keep passing by. While an 18-inch snowfall is just another day for them, these weather systems are bringing unusually frigid temperatures with them. And these record cold air systems are reaching all the way down to Texas and Florida. Some truly record cold temps. in Texas. Over in Europe, snow is making the news. Some places in England are literally buried today (and canceling some of the horse racing!) and most of western Europe is facing the same cold/snow combo. that we are here.
